A Legacy of Excellence

History and Mission

Founded in 1914, OSU Optometry has grown from a modest program into one of the leading optometry schools in the United States. The college’s mission is to advance the art and science of optometry through education, research, and patient care. This mission is reflected in the rigorous academic curriculum, cutting-edge research initiatives, and the comprehensive clinical training provided to students.

Academic Programs and Training

Doctor of Optometry (OD) Program

The Doctor of Optometry program at OSU is renowned for its comprehensive curriculum that integrates basic and clinical sciences with hands-on clinical experience. Students undergo rigorous training in diagnosing and managing a wide range of eye conditions, preparing them for successful careers in optometry. The program emphasizes evidence-based practice, ensuring that graduates are equipped with the latest knowledge and skills in the field.

Residency Programs

OSU Optometry offers a variety of residency programs that provide advanced clinical training in areas such as ocular disease, contact lenses, pediatrics, and vision therapy. These programs are designed for optometrists seeking to specialize in a particular area of practice, offering them the opportunity to work alongside experienced faculty members who are leaders in their respective fields.

Clinical Services and Community Impact

Optometry Services Clinic

The OSU Optometry Services Clinic is a state-of-the-art facility where students gain hands-on experience while providing high-quality care to patients. The clinic offers a full range of eye care services, including comprehensive eye exams, contact lens fittings, and the treatment of ocular diseases. The clinic’s commitment to patient-centered care ensures that every patient receives personalized treatment tailored to their specific needs.

Community Outreach

OSU Optometry is deeply committed to serving the community through various outreach programs. These initiatives include providing free eye exams to underserved populations, participating in vision screenings in local schools, and offering educational workshops on eye health. Through these efforts, the college plays a vital role in improving eye care access and education in the community.
